Planning Your Long Distance Move
Moving long distance can be a daunting task, but with the right planning, it can be a manageable and even enjoyable experience. Start by creating a comprehensive checklist to keep track of all the tasks you need to complete. This will help you stay organized and ensure nothing is overlooked. Consider starting the planning process at least two months in advance to give yourself ample time to handle unexpected issues.

Selecting a Reliable Moving Company
One of the most critical steps in a long distance move is choosing the right moving company. Research several companies, read reviews, and ask for recommendations from friends or family. Obtain quotes from at least three different movers and compare their services and pricing. Ensure the company you choose is licensed and insured, providing you with peace of mind throughout the process.
Packing Like a Pro
Packing efficiently is key to a stress-free move. Begin with decluttering your home and deciding which items you truly need to take with you. Donate or sell items you no longer use. Use high-quality packing materials to protect your belongings, and label each box clearly with its contents and destination room. This will make unpacking at your new home much easier.

Handling Fragile Items
Special care is needed for fragile items. Wrap each item individually with bubble wrap or packing paper, and use sturdy boxes. Label these boxes as "fragile" and ensure they are placed securely in the moving truck to prevent damage. Consider transporting valuable or delicate items yourself if possible.
Managing the Transition
Once you arrive at your new home, take time to settle in gradually. Unpack essentials first, such as kitchenware and bedding, to make your new space livable. Explore your new neighborhood and familiarize yourself with local amenities and services. This will help you feel more at home and ease the transition.

Staying Organized During the Move
Maintaining organization throughout your move is crucial. Keep important documents, such as contracts and identification, in a dedicated folder that you carry with you. Use a moving app or planner to track your progress and adjust your plans as needed. Staying organized will reduce stress and ensure a smoother moving experience.
